最新 最热

Java高级工程师常见面试题(一)-Java基础「建议收藏」

HashMap基于哈希表的 Map 接口的实现。允许使用 null 值和 null 键。此类不保证映射的顺序,特别是它不保证该顺序恒久不变。

2022-09-01
1

android bindservice方法,Android bindservice方法返回false

我想从另一个类(BaseExpandableListAdapter)的活动中调用一个方法。活动中的方法启动服务并调用bindService(,,)方法。但是,bindService方法总是返回false。我查了其他类似的帖子,但没有一个解决了我的问题。任何评论非...

2022-09-01
1

Java集合分类以及各自特点

常用的就是ArrayList,LinkedList,HashSet,LinkedHashSet,TreeSet,HashMap,LinkedHashMap,TreeMap; 数组和集合的区别 区别1: 数组可以存储基本数据类型/引用数据类型 基本数据类型存的是值 引用数据类型存的是地...

2022-09-01
1

Map集合和List集合总结

List集合是一个元素有序(存储有序)、可重复的集合,集合中的每个元素都有对应的索引,以便于查询和修改,List集合是允许存储null值的。

2022-08-31
1

《深入理解mybatis原理》 MyBatis的一级缓存实现详解 及使用注意事项

MyBatis是一个简单,小巧但功能非常强大的ORM开源框架,它的功能强大也体现在它的缓存机制上。MyBatis提供了一级缓存、二级缓存 这两个缓存机制,能够很好地处理和维护缓存,以提高系统的性能。本文的目的则是向读者详细介绍...

2022-08-31
1

面试被问到HashMap 底层原理?看完这边文章绝对不慌!

存储:put 方法 put(key,value) 查询 : get 方法 get(key) java 代码如下

2022-08-31
1

java map转json字符_Map转JSON字符串

[java]代码库package com.smartAnji.control.utils;

2022-08-31
1

HashMap底层数据结构原理解析[通俗易懂]

老师:JDK中我们最常用的一个数据类是HashMap。那么,谁可以回答一下HashMap的底层数据结构原理是什么呢?

2022-08-31
1

HashMap数据结构及其一些方法

数组存储区间是连续的,占用内存严重,故空间复杂的很大。但数组的二分查找时间复杂度小,为O(1);数组的特点是:寻址容易,插入和删除困难;

2022-08-31
1

一、HashMap数据结构

大家好,又见面了,我是你们的朋友全栈君。HashMap数据结构 1、HashMap介绍 hash就是散列,就是把对象在内存中打散,其目的就是查询速度更快。 如何做到查询速度快? 哈希码...

2022-08-31
1